When selecting the materials for your treehouse, it's important to choose sturdy and durable woods that can withstand heavy weight. Pine is a popular choice for framing as it is inexpensive, simple to work with, and long-lasting. Plywood can be used to construct the structure of a treehouse. It is more resistant than traditional lumber to water damage. If you're using plywood, make sure it is the exterior grade plywood. It won't crack or rot when exposed to water.
Once you have the frame of your boy treehouse bed completed, it's time to start building the wall sections. Start by cutting and measuring studs that will be used for the walls. Join them using your framing nails. To ensure the best stability, you should choose vertical studs every 16 inches. If you want, leave enough space between each stud to allow for windows or doors. When the walls are completed, you can trim the door frames and windows for a more polished appearance.
The foundation is among the most important parts of any treehouse. The strength and durability of your construction will depend on the tree you choose. A solid oak, maple, or hickory tree is usually best for treehouses, as they are sturdy and have broad trunks that can support the weight of the structure. Avoid trees with shallow roots as they may not be able to support the weight of a treehouse.
